Potemkins Palace, Dnepropetrovsk, Ukraine
Palace of Potiomkin 1786, park of rest by it. T.Shevchenko. One of the first most significant buildings of Dnepropetrovsk . The authorship of the project of a palace is attributed to oustanding Russian architect I. Starovu. Originally main case contained a line of smart rooms, including huge twice colour a hall in the central part. In 1952 has been reconstructed and became a palace of culture of students.
